The first stop is in Parte Vieja, the historic old town where pintxos are a fundamental part of local life. Here, the guide takes you through some of the best bars with carefully selected pintxos, showcasing a variety of flavors and styles. The emphasis is on quality and authenticity, with each bar chosen for its reputation and excellence in serving traditional pintxos.
In Parte Vieja, the competitive spirit of street word of mouth influences the selection, ensuring you enjoy only the top-rated offerings. You’ll find a mix of prize-winning pintxos and those beloved by locals, giving you a true taste of what makes San Sebastián celebrated for its gastronomy.

The lunch aspect is a highlight, with 3 pintxos paired with 3 drinks. The drinks include regional favorites such as txakoli, a slightly fizzy, dry white wine, and cider, adding local character to each bite. The guide ensures that each pairing complements the pintxos perfectly, elevating the tasting experience.
